Natural leather seat covers have long been connected with deluxe and class. They offer a streamlined and elegant appearance that can immediately elevate the interior of any automobile. Natural leather is also known for its durability and durability. Unlike textile seat covers, leather is less susceptible to tearing or fraying in time. It is also immune to discolorations and spills, making it easier to clean up and keep. However, leather seat covers can be rather pricey compared to textile alternatives. They can additionally become warm and sticky in warm weather, and cold and rigid in winter. Furthermore, natural leather seat covers might not be the best selection for those with animals or kids, as they can easily scratch or damage the leather surface.

On the other hand, fabric seat covers deal a wide range of options in terms of shades, patterns, and appearances. They are often more affordable than leather seat covers, making them a prominent option for budget-conscious cars and truck owners. Material seat covers are likewise generally more comfortable, as they have a tendency to be softer and extra breathable than leather. They are less affected by temperature adjustments and do not come to be warm or chilly to the touch. Nevertheless, material seat covers are much more susceptible to discoloration and fading with time. They might likewise be more difficult to tidy, specifically if they are not treated with a stain-resistant layer. Material seat covers might additionally be much more at risk to wear and tear, and might need to be changed much more regularly than leather seat covers.

Sturdiness and Durability



When it concerns durability and long life, leather seat covers stand out over material ones.

Leather is recognized for its stamina and resistance to deterioration. It can endure years of use without revealing substantial indicators of damages.

Unlike material, leather is much less prone to staining and can be quickly wiped clean, making it perfect for unpleasant circumstances such as spills or crashes.

In addition, leather seat covers have a tendency to maintain their form and form in time, while fabric covers might come to be stretched or saggy.

With proper care and upkeep, leather seat covers can last for years, adding value to your vehicle and supplying an elegant and timeless appearance.
